Output 40db088520df033ed97247be7f78fe1eed2985b9e2a81eee3a8b71dc8d0d60aa:1

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d850fdd8c753509174f9c0e81c14244f7c58cf33 OP_EQUAL
address
3MQnuNcKZTrjy6kndZaktQKfPfFrxdAu1r
transaction
40db088520df033ed97247be7f78fe1eed2985b9e2a81eee3a8b71dc8d0d60aa
spent
true